HVAC Control Module Scan Tool Output Controls

Scan Tool Output Control

Additional Menu Selection(s)

Description

A/C Permission

Miscellaneous Tests

When you select ON, the HVAC control module changes the state of the A/C Permission parameter to Granted and transmits a clutch enable message to the PCM over the class 2 serial data circuit. The A/C compressor clutch engages and remains engaged until you select OFF. When you select OFF, the HVAC control module changes the state of the A/C Permission parameter to Withheld and transmits a clutch disable message to the PCM over the class 2 serial data circuit.

Left Mix Motor

Motor/Actuator Tests

When you select ON, the HVAC control module commands the left air temperature actuator toward the maximum door position. The actuator moves the door to the full hot position. When you select OFF, the HVAC control module commands the left air temperature actuator toward the minimum door position. The actuator moves the door to the full cold position.

Mode 1 Door Position

Motor/Actuator Tests

When you select ON, the HVAC control module commands the mode actuator toward the maximum door position. The actuator moves the door to the panel position. When you select OFF, the HVAC control module commands the mode actuator toward the minimum door position. The actuator moves the door to the floor position.

Right Mix Motor

Motor/Actuator Tests

When you select ON, the HVAC control module commands the right air temperature actuator toward the maximum door position. The actuator moves the door to the full cold position. When you select OFF, the HVAC control module commands the right air temperature actuator toward the minimum door position. The actuator moves the door to the full hot position.

PCM Scan Tool Output Controls

Scan Tool Output Control

Additional Menu Selection(s)

Description

A/C Relay

Engine Output Controls

The engine must be running and the PCM must receive an A/C request from the HVAC control module in order to enable the output control. The PCM de-energizes the A/C compressor clutch relay when you select OFF. The relay remains de-energized until you select ON.
